Acting Prime Minister Avdullah Hoti, along with Ministers Hykmete Bajrami and Besian Mustafa, has met business representatives in the Prizren municipality to discuss government plans about economic development.
Hoti has said that she and the ministers have talked with businesses about completing 2020, but also their plans for 2021.
“Today, we had a meeting with the business community, along with some of the ministers to discuss the conclusion of 2020, our economic recovery package for 2020, and the plans we now have for 2021, to get comments and suggestions from businesses”, he said.
Hoti has said that 2020 was a difficult year, but that they have managed to ease the situation with the economic package and the Economic Regeneration Law.
He has said that during this meeting they have proposed the Kosovo Government's ideas on economic policies, but have also received ideas from businesses.
It's been a difficult year, we've designed a package of economic recovery that in relative terms is beautiful, worth 360 million, and plus the economic recovery law that mobilised hundreds of millions of euros directly and indirectly. Now we're starting a new start, we have another package of economic recovery, 222m euros. We received good proposals from businesses, and we also proposed our ideas for economic policies during 2021”, he said.
Hoti hopes the pandemic will be overcome so that the country's institutions can deal with economic development, as well as focus on Kosovo politics.
